Police investigate robbery, homicide in KCMO

A man was robbed and then fatally shot Tuesday morning while walking near St. John and Cypress.

Police were originally called to an outside disturbance after reports of shots being fired about 4:45 a.m.

When officers arrived, they discovered a man lying on the sidewalk with a gunshot wound.

He told officers the suspect approached him, took his belongings, including his phone and shot him. Officers said the man was outside trying to find Wi-Fi for his phone.

The man was transported to a local hospital in critical condition and later died of his injuries. The victim was identified as Corey L. Walls, 35, of KCMO. 

Police searched the area for a suspect, but were unable to locate the gunman.

The area has seen it's share of crime, just yesterday there was a reported robbery blocks away from St. John and Cypress. On November 16, there were two reported assaults and on November 12 there was a breaking and entering case a block away at St. John and Elmwood. 

Police say this is the 109th homicide this year.
